Apple has already released a fix for its embarrassing privilege escalation bug. If you haven’t already, open the App Store, go to Updates, and install Security Update 2017-001. However, after installing that you may notice that file sharing no longer works. In order to fix this problem you need to perform the following steps:
- Open the Terminal app, which is in the Utilities folder of your Applications folder.
- Type
sudo /usr/libexec/configureLocalKDC
and press Return.- Enter your administrator password and press Return.
- Quit the Terminal app.
In conclusion High Sierra is still a steaming pile of shit and you should stick to Sierra if you can.